Import contribute site in dreamweaver

I want to import the site I currently manage in contribute in dreamweaver to see if it is an easier way to manager.  How do I do this?

Have you ever used Dreamweaver?
How good are you with HTML and CSS code?
Go to Site > New Site and tell DW where on your hard drive you wish to keep your local site folder.
Enter your remote server FTP credentials.
From the Files Panel, Click on the Down Arrow to GET files from your remote web server.

  • Edit Existing Site With Dreamweaver

    Im sure this question has been asked 100 times but how do I edit an existing site (published and on the web) with Dreamweaver CS5.5? I took over as webmaster last month at a company and would like to edit the companys website. How do I download the files off the web? I can do it with Contribute but not Dreamweaver.

    Create a local site folder in DW.  Site > Manage Sites > New.
    Go to Advanced > Remote info and enter your log in-details (FTP, host URL, username, password).
    Test connection to server.
    Then GET files from server.
